Special minister of state Brough confirms he was visited by Australian federal police investigating the leak of the former Speaker’s diary The Turnbull government minister Mal Brough has handed over documents to Australian federal police officers investigating the leak of the former Speaker Peter Slipper’s diary.
Brough,the special minister of state, issued a statement on Thursday saying he was willing to meet with the AFP to discuss claims relating to his contact with Slipper’s former staffer James Ashby.
